    India Silicon Carbide Market Summary

    The India Silicon Carbide market is projected to grow significantly from 68.3 USD Million in 2024 to 238.8 USD Million by 2035.

    Key Market Trends & Highlights

    India Silicon Carbide Key Trends and Highlights

    • The market is expected to experience a compound annual growth rate of 12.05 percent from 2025 to 2035.
    • By 2035, the market valuation is anticipated to reach 238.8 USD Million, indicating robust growth potential.
    • In 2024, the market is valued at 68.3 USD Million, reflecting a strong foundation for future expansion.
    • Growing adoption of advanced semiconductor technologies due to increasing demand for energy-efficient solutions is a major market driver.

    Market Size & Forecast

    2024 Market Size 68.3 (USD Million)
    2035 Market Size 238.8 (USD Million)
    CAGR (2025-2035) 12.05%

    Silicon Carbide Market Product Type Insights

    The India Silicon Carbide Market is diversely categorized, with Product Type serving as a crucial segment that encompasses various forms of silicon carbide, predominantly Black Silicon Carbide and Green Silicon Carbide. Black Silicon Carbide is known for its excellent hardness, high thermal conductivity, and superior resistance to wear and oxidation, making it highly sought after in industries such as abrasives, ceramics, and refractory materials.

    This type is predominantly utilized in grinding wheels, sandpaper, and various abrasive tools, underscoring its vital role in manufacturing and construction industries, particularly in India, where infrastructural advancements continue to thrive. On the other hand, Green Silicon Carbide, recognized for its purity and superior strength, has carved a niche in high-performance applications.

    It is primarily used in the production of advanced ceramics and abrasives while also showing its significance in semiconductor applications due to its wide bandgap properties, which make it suitable for high-temperature and high-voltage electronics. The growing focus on clean energy technologies, particularly in India’s push towards renewable energy, positions Green Silicon Carbide as a critical component in the manufacturing of power electronics, which are integral to solar energy systems and electric vehicles. The Indian government’s initiatives to enhance manufacturing capabilities and support innovative technologies further bolster the importance of these Product Types in the Silicon Carbide Market.

    As the country strives to become a global manufacturing hub, the demand for both Black and Green Silicon Carbide is expected to grow, fueled by sectors such as automotive, aerospace, and electronics, thereby driving significant market growth. The shift towards sustainability and environmentally friendly products also positions these types favorably as industries worldwide pursue greener alternatives. Overall, the dynamics around Black and Green Silicon Carbide highlight their critical contribution to the overall landscape of the India Silicon Carbide Market, with continued advancements likely to further enhance their market presence and application scope.

    Silicon Carbide Market Application Insights

    The Application segment of the India Silicon Carbide Market plays a crucial role in various industries, significantly impacting both growth and technological advancement. The demand for silicon carbide in the Steel and Energy sector is increasing due to its superior thermal conductivity and strength, which are vital for high-temperature applications.

    In the Automotive industry, the push towards electric vehicles has heightened the need for efficient power electronics that enhance overall vehicle performance. The Aerospace and Aviation sector benefits from silicon carbide's lightweight and durable properties, making it essential for high-performance components.

    In Military and Defense, the material's ability to withstand extreme conditions makes it suitable for various applications such as armor and sensors. The Electronics and Semiconductors industry is experiencing growth as silicon carbide facilitates faster and more efficient electronic devices, catering to the increasing demand for advancements in technology. Lastly, the medical and healthcare field is leveraging silicon carbide's biocompatibility for various applications, from imaging to prosthetics. Overall, these segments reflect a strong inclination towards adopting silicon carbide, driven by technological innovations and energy efficiency targets set by government initiatives in India.

    Industry Developments

    In recent months, the India Silicon Carbide Market has witnessed significant developments, particularly driven by advances in semiconductor technologies. Companies such as On Semiconductor and Infineon Technologies have ramped up their operational capabilities in India to meet the growing demand for power-efficient devices.

    In August 2023, Mitsubishi Chemical announced a strategic investment to enhance its production capacity for silicon carbide components in India, reflecting a growing trend in the regional market. Moreover, in July 2023, Dow Corning expanded its R&D facilities, focusing on silicon carbide applications for electric mobility and renewable energy sectors.

    Power Integrations and Cree are also leveraging partnerships to innovate silicon carbide technologies, catering to the automotive and electronics industries. Notably, SK Siltron has made strides towards increasing its market share, providing advanced materials for next-generation semiconductors.

    While sector growth has been impressive, there have been no major mergers or acquisitions reported among the companies within this space in India recently. The overall valuation of the India Silicon Carbide Market is witnessing a positive trajectory, indicating increased investment and development activity that is crucial for the country’s ambitions in the semiconductor sector.
